Apple Inc.
Retail Channel Program Manager, Middle East
United Arab Emirates, AE - Computer Hardware, Computer Software
The Channel Program Manager is responsible for Apple branded program deployment in a multi-brand environment, & telco channel along with enterprise & commercial / event management support.
Key Qualifications:
•Solid working experience in retail marketing and project management.
•Ability of taking hands-on work and attention to detail is required.
•Has worked for a high profile, image-conscious, consumer brand.
•Brand/marketing communications experience ideally from leading consumer electronics or telecoms manufacturers, or account handlers from global marketing agencies.
•Used to interfacing with various teams including sales teams, B2B teams and retail staff.
•A good team player with effective communication skills and coordination skills.
•High accountability & self-motivated and be able to work under minimal supervision and deliver the assigned task result.
•Good written and spoken English.
Description:
The specific roles and responsibilities include the following:
1) Program implementation.
Implement Apple branded program in the Middle East markets by cooperating with other functions.
Be fully responsible for Apple branded program setup in multi-brand environment & carrier/telco stores, including space planning, brief preparation, site survey, installation and merchandising support.
2) Cross function teams cooperation within the programs team & sales organisation.
Interact with central teams to fully understand program guidelines.
Work closely with sales team & ASC teams to ensure growing Apple business with new program.
Support system data entry and additional admin tasks as needed.
Help update my pipeline and collect relevant information for the briefs including sales numbers & images of the POS.
3) External parties coordination / management
Review and negotiate with resellers for best in-store location for program implementation
Coordinate vendors in store installation timings and plans
Be on site with external vendors during installations/removal of programs.
4) B2B/Event Management
Support business development Managers (BDM) to complete the project plans where necessary
Support the sell-in to the B2B partners whenever required
Prepare the BEP launch events including submitting the PR for the event and manage the subsequent finance process
Source and manage agencies to help with the B2B briefings and launch events
Liaise with meetings & events to book venues for the briefings/other events
Support BDM’s in measuring program performance & generate the post activity reports.
Work cross functionally with the training team, B2B teams & account managers & carrier managers.
5) Seeding
Help coordinate the seeding program across the Middle East partners
Manage and track the process and ensure alignment with the BDM & account managers
